February  2011 will mark the start of my twelfth year as a criminal defense  attorney.  I spent the first four and a half years, after graduating  from Cornell Law School, working as a state prosecutor, both in  Philadelphia, Pennsylvania and Atlanta, Georgia. The last eleven years, I  have defended individuals accused of all types of crimes.  During those  fifteen years, I worked an average of seventy hours a week, and saw my  fair share of justice and lunacy. 
If  you have been arrested and/or charged with a criminal offense, you are  about to enter the arcane world of criminal law. My first piece of  advice in selecting a good criminal defense attorney is similar to the  advice offered in selecting a good attorney: Have a trusted family  attorney, or family friend that practices law, refer you to a criminal  defense attorney. If you do not have such a resource, then you need to  take heed of the following advice.
